WebApr 7, 2024 · To check the PowerShell version installed in your system, you can use either $PSVersionTable or $host command. Check if $host command available in remote servers. Open the PowerShell console in the system and run the command $PSVersionTable. $PSVersionTable Output WebMay 29, 2024 · You can use PowerShell to obtain the version information for a file. WebNov 11, 2024 · List all installed PowerShell modules on your computer The below command will list all installed modules. This does not mean they are loaded into your PowerShell session but are installed and available.
